Federal Figuratively speaking

Federal funds are given by the You.S. Company out-of Degree. Are entitled to federal financing, college students need finish the FAFSA. The kinds of government college loans used by youngsters from the School of Breastfeeding are as follows:

The newest Federal Head Unsubsidized Financing can be used to help coverage a good student’s costs. Students will not need to demonstrate financial you prefer. The absolute most that may be lent a year is actually $20,five hundred. Desire for the loan accrues while students try signed up for university and is added to the main of one’s financing. Youngsters submit an application for brand new Government Direct Unsubsidized Loan from the finishing the fresh FAFSA. Individual Money

Individual student education loans are provided by the banking companies, credit unions, or other types of lenders. The bank otherwise bank, not the government, sets the eye prices, loan limitations, terms and conditions, and you can requirements of your financing. Being qualified to have and you can borrowing an exclusive education loan could be depending towards numerous issues that can are credit score, a good co-signer as well as their credit rating, earnings, and you can system from https://paydayloansindiana.org/ investigation. Johns Hopkins School does not recommend otherwise strongly recommend one lender, nor really does the newest College or university have a financial interest in one lending place. We shall procedure an application regarding lender of your choice. It is recommended that you first exhaust their qualification for everybody government loan software ahead of provided a supplemental loan. As with all fund, you are encouraged to obtain just all you have to see the educational costs.

Nursing assistant Professors Mortgage System

The intention of the fresh NFLP will be to help inserted nurses that have doing their graduate studies to become accredited nurse professors. Recipients receive that loan as much as $thirty-five,five hundred a year for their graduate training. The application also provides partial loan forgiveness to possess individuals just who graduate and act as complete-time nursing professors toward prescribed time period.
